Frequently asked questions about this sector

How many community-development economic and community development charities are there in the UK?

There are 2,174 registered community-development economic and community development charities on the Charity Commission for England and Wales register at the most recent refresh.

Which is the largest of the community-development economic and community development charities by income?

Lloyd's Register Foundation is the largest by latest reported annual income (£691.7m). Notable peers are listed on this page; the full ranking is available by sorting the results by highest income.

What is the combined annual income of community-development economic and community development charities?

Community-development economic and community development charities reported a combined annual income of £9.9bn across their most recent filings with the Charity Commission.

What is a typical program ratio for community-development economic and community development charities?

Across all community-development economic and community development charities, the aggregate program ratio (charitable expenditure as a share of income) is 79.4%. Individual charity ratios vary widely — see each profile for a sector-band benchmark.

What is the average annual income of community-development economic and community development charities?

Community-development economic and community development charities have an average annual income of £963k. The distribution is heavily skewed: a small number of large charities account for most sector income, while the majority report under £100k a year.
